Smith-Neale stuns Durrant to win Winmau World Masters title

Once again the Winmau World Masters has a surprising winner. The victory went to Adam Smith-Neale, who beat Glen Durrant in the final.

Smith-Neale completed a successful week, after beating Daniel Day, Mark McGeeney and Wayne Warren earlier at the Winmau World Masters. The 24-year-old will now make his debut at the BDO World Championship in January.
Durrant had a 4-3 lead in the final and had two darts to make it 5-3. However, Duzza missed on double 18 and double 9. His compatriot hit the double and made it 4-4 in an exciting contest. Smith-Neale took over the momentum from the two-time Lakeside champion and hit tops in the tenth set to claim the title.
Lisa Ashton won her second Winmau World Masters title after defeating Casey Gallagher 5-2 in the final.
All matches were streamed on Winmau TV.
